The Challenges of Cross-lingual Understanding: Navigating the Linguistic Labyrinth

Cross-lingual understanding presents unique challenges for AI, as it requires the ability to navigate the vast diversity and complexity of human languages:

  • Structural Differences: Adapting to Linguistic Landscapes: Languages exhibit a remarkable diversity in their grammatical structures, word orders, and ways of expressing concepts. AI needs to be able to adapt to these differences, like a seasoned traveler navigating unfamiliar terrain, to understand and reason across languages. This involves recognizing that the same concept can be expressed in vastly different ways, requiring AI to develop a flexible and adaptable approach to language processing.

  • Cultural Nuances: Deciphering the Cultural Code: Languages are deeply intertwined with culture, and words and phrases can carry different connotations and meanings across cultures, like hidden symbols in a foreign land. AI needs to be sensitive to these cultural nuances, like a cultural anthropologist deciphering the customs and beliefs of different societies, to avoid misinterpretations and ensure accurate understanding. This involves recognizing that language is not just a tool for communication but also a reflection of cultural values, beliefs, and perspectives.

  • Data Scarcity: Overcoming the Resource Gap: While some languages have abundant data available for training AI models, others have limited resources, creating a digital divide in the world of AI. This can make it challenging to develop AI systems that can understand and reason across all languages, particularly for low-resource languages. AI researchers are exploring techniques like transfer learning and data augmentation to overcome this challenge and ensure that AI benefits all languages and cultures.


Techniques for Cross-lingual Understanding: Building Bridges Across Languages

AI researchers are developing and refining various techniques to overcome these challenges and enable cross-lingual understanding:

  • Multilingual Embeddings: Creating a Shared Linguistic Space: These techniques map words and phrases from different languages into a shared vector space, like creating a universal map where different languages converge. This allows AI to identify similarities and relationships between languages, even if they have different structures and expressions. By representing words and phrases as vectors in a shared space, AI can compare and contrast their meanings across languages, uncovering hidden connections and facilitating cross-lingual understanding.

  • Cross-lingual Transfer Learning: Sharing Knowledge Across Borders: This approach involves training AI models on one language and then transferring that knowledge to another language, like a student learning from multiple teachers. This enables AI to learn from multiple languages, leveraging the strengths of each language to improve its overall understanding. For example, an AI model trained on English text can be fine-tuned on a smaller dataset of French text, allowing it to leverage its knowledge of English to better understand French.

  • Machine Translation: A Stepping Stone to Understanding: While primarily used for translation, machine translation can also be a valuable tool for cross-lingual understanding. By translating text from one language to another, AI can access and process information in different languages, expanding its knowledge base and enabling it to reason across linguistic boundaries. This can be particularly useful for tasks like cross-lingual information retrieval and question answering.


The Applications of Cross-lingual Understanding: A World of Possibilities

Cross-lingual understanding has the potential to revolutionize various fields, breaking down language barriers and fostering global communication and collaboration:

  • Global Communication: Connecting People Across Cultures: AI can facilitate communication and collaboration between people who speak different languages, breaking down communication barriers and fostering understanding. This can enable seamless communication in business, education, healthcare, and other domains, promoting cross-cultural exchange and collaboration.

  • Cross-cultural Research: Uncovering Global Insights: AI can analyze and compare information across different languages, enabling researchers to gain insights into different cultures, perspectives, and worldviews. This can lead to a deeper understanding of human behavior, social dynamics, and cultural diversity, fostering empathy and collaboration across cultures.

  • Multilingual Information Retrieval: Accessing Global Knowledge: AI can search and retrieve information from multilingual sources, making knowledge more accessible to a global audience. This can empower individuals and organizations to access information in their preferred language, breaking down information barriers and promoting knowledge sharing across linguistic boundaries.

  • Personalized Learning: Adapting to Diverse Learners: AI can adapt educational materials and resources to different languages and learning styles, making education more accessible and effective for diverse learners. This can personalize the learning experience, cater to individual needs, and promote inclusivity in education.
